Output 2e691662c708031ffbe9143dec2a57df0ef7b765f0db074c59e595240baf4733:0

value
31457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7d5823fd200ab66948e20dbff00a29bc8a4b88 OP_EQUALVERIFY OP_CHECKSIG
address
1MHRAfLPxGFNmFBvgdfricowUgZYR4opb7
transaction
2e691662c708031ffbe9143dec2a57df0ef7b765f0db074c59e595240baf4733
confirmations
253268
spent
true